Briefing on Web Analytics and the Yahoo! acquisition of IndexTools

I am participating in a Snow Valley briefing on how the Yahoo! acquisition of IndexTools affects the web analytics market. Thursday 3rd July 2008.

- An introduction to Index Tools and how it can help your business
- How organisations can get access to Index Tools now
- What the deal means for clients using Index Tools already
- How Index Tools compares to other analytics packages in the market
- How to get the most from Index Tools
